Notorious terrorist leader Bello Turji on the run as son, others killed during fierce battle

Bello Turji is currently running for his life as Troops of Operation Fansan Yamma said it had killed scores of terrorists, including the son of the wanted terror kingpin during a raid in Zamfara.

A statement issued by the Director Defence Media Operations of the Armed Forces, Major General Edward Buba yesterday, said the feat was achieved on January 17, during a coordinated operation between troops of Operation FANSAN YAMMA, as well as the air component conducted clearance operations along Shinkafi, Kagara, Fakai, Moriki, Maiwa and Chindo axis.

The operations killed scores of terrorists including notorious terrorist leader, Bello Turji’s son on Fakai high ground where the terrorists were hiding, the statement said.

The Army’s statement comes after news of his son’s and loyalists’ deaths circulated in the Arewa community on X leaving most of the posters excited.

Security analyst, Zagazola Makama, broke the news on his verified X account on Saturday night, adding that the terrorist kingpin was on the run.

According to the statement by the Army, the intensity of troops ‘ power resulted in high terrorist casualties and their logistics hub destroyed.

The operations also resulted in the rescue of several kidnapped hostages held captive by Turji.

“The terrorist leader, Bello Turji, in a gross cowardly act escaped abandoning his son and combatants,” the statement added.

In a related development, the troops said they also destroyed another terrorist kingpin camp known as Idi Mallam along Zango Kagara Forest.

During the encounter, the troops said they neutralised three terrorists and arrested three suspected collaborators.

“Furthermore, troops recovered two machine guns, one AK47 Rifle with a magazine containing 11 rounds of 7.62 mm ammunition. Additionally, 61 rustled cattle, and 44 sheep were rescued among other sundry items.

“Troops are sustaining the onslaught against the terrorist. Overall, troops continue to demonstrate commitment to the safety and protection of all citizens across the country,” the statement added.
